Output 61b695410eb21c34e37ea4a03327f5cf5a860c5ac5eaf33450e9a703725d6dc8:5

value
154589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ceb0edb97b8ee03e0c102dacf6be869666d7e4d OP_EQUAL
address
3EY87X3bU2cSKEKQU9AL3kchWKoEHffL8E
transaction
61b695410eb21c34e37ea4a03327f5cf5a860c5ac5eaf33450e9a703725d6dc8
spent
true